Points
Two winding transformer
Autotransformer
Symbol
image
image
Number of windings
It has two windings
It has one winding 
Copper saving
Copper saving is less
Copper saving takes more as compared to two winding
Size
Size is large 
Size is small 
cost
Cost is high
Cost is low
Losses in winding
More losses takes place
Less losses takes place 
Efficiency
Efficiency is low
Efficiency is high
Regulation
Regulation is poor
Regulation is better
Electrical isolation
Electrical isolation is present in between primary and secondary winding
There is no electrical isolation
Movable contact 
Movable contact is not present
Movable contact is present 
Application
Mains transformer, power supply, welding, isolation transformer
Variac, starting of ac motors, dimmerstat.
